Transaction 6f7f346dedbad83134c2b380f766b92ea67ec3bb66a4cb35179d6ce6fd6fc27b
1 Input
1 Output
-
6f7f346dedbad83134c2b380f766b92ea67ec3bb66a4cb35179d6ce6fd6fc27b:0
- value
- 21249320
- script pubkey
- OP_0 OP_PUSHBYTES_20 80c716d9ea7808e5c891e91efc08c48b77cc661b
- address
- bc1qsrr3dk020qywtjy3ay00czxy3dmucesm7p8ec5